5 and you have forgotten the challenge addressed to you as God's sons, "My son, do not think lightly of the Lord's discipline, Or give up when he corrects you.
6 For it is those whom the Lord loves that he disciplines, And he chastises every son that he acknowledges."
7 You must submit to it as discipline. God is dealing with you as his sons. For where is there a son whom his father does not discipline?
8 But if you have none of that discipline which all sons undergo, you are illegitimate children, and not true sons.
9 When our earthly fathers disciplined us we treated them with respect; should we not far more submit to the Father of our spirits, and so have life?
